Scam signs

When you want to know whether a site is a legit store or fake one thing you should not forget to do is check for their contact details. Scammers usually don’t leave a phone number to avoid getting tracked but if they do that number will not be a real one. The phone number +86 17100951552 being used by the site does not work and I could tell that before I even tried it. Complaints have already been issued out by some who have bought that the transactions are being sent to different receiving accounts. Others have also reported that the site is a scam based on the very much unrealistic prices that the site is charging. I for one have learned not to trust a new site. Do you know when this site was created? It is too new to be trusted and was created on the 13 of November 2019. Of course the owner of the site is not known.

    I made a purchase from this Bogus website. I never received a confirmation email and they do not respond to emails. The sale still says pending processing after 4 days. The company is based in China but my PayPal payment was sent to an individual in California which said it was a construction company. I have opened a case with PayPal and my bank.
